Combined Risk – Understanding Multiple Health Threats

When dealing with combined risk, the simultaneous occurrence of two or more health hazards that amplify each other’s impact. Also known as multiple risk interaction, it often shows up in medication side‑effects, chronic diseases, and lifestyle factors. In plain terms, the whole becomes riskier than the sum of its parts. This concept drives everything from how doctors choose a drug regimen to how patients monitor everyday symptoms. One major source of combined risk is drug side‑effects that overlap. Take photosensitivity, a heightened skin reaction to sunlight caused by certain medications as an example. When a patient on a photosensitizing drug steps into strong sun, the skin damage isn’t just a simple rash – it adds to the overall risk profile, especially if the person already has a condition like lupus. Combined risk therefore includes not only the drug’s primary action but also the secondary ways it can aggravate other health issues. This is why clinicians routinely ask about sun exposure before prescribing meds that can trigger photosensitivity.

Chronic illnesses often stack on top of each other, creating a perfect storm of combined risk. Rheumatoid arthritis, an autoimmune disorder that inflames joints and can affect other organs is a case in point. The disease itself raises cardiovascular risk, and many of the drugs used to control it, like methotrexate, carry their own side‑effects such as liver strain. When rheumatoid arthritis meets a statin‑related issue, the combined risk for heart problems climbs dramatically. Understanding how these conditions intersect helps patients and doctors weigh benefits against potential harms.

High cholesterol adds another layer to the risk equation. High cholesterol, elevated levels of LDL cholesterol that increase the chance of plaque buildup in arteries often co‑exists with hypertension, diabetes, or obesity. Adding a statin like rosuvastatin may lower LDL, but long‑term use can bring muscle pain or affect liver enzymes, which in turn feeds back into the overall risk picture. The combined risk here isn’t just about a single lab number; it’s about how medication side‑effects intersect with existing cardiovascular strain.

Even seemingly unrelated symptoms can tie back to combined risk. Vaginal burning, a painful sensation often linked to infections, hormonal changes, or medication side‑effects may look isolated, but it can signal an underlying imbalance that raises infection risk elsewhere in the body. If a patient is also taking a drug that alters gut flora, the compounded effect may increase susceptibility to both intestinal and vaginal infections. Spotting such links early can prevent a cascade of health problems that would otherwise pile up as combined risk.

All these examples show that combined risk isn’t a single factor – it’s a network of interactions among drugs, diseases, and lifestyle choices.
